A majority of U.S. corporations—approximately 80%—now have an immigrant in a top leadership role, yet recent Trump administration visa restrictions are forcing many to prepare backup strategies. Hiba Mona Anver, partner at Erickson Immigration Group, warned at Fortune’s Workforce Innovation Summit that companies must adopt policies to navigate heightened uncertainty around H-1B visa processing.

In December 2025, Apple and Google issued a clear directive to employees on work visas: avoid international travel to reduce the risk of being barred from reentering the United States. The Trump administration had introduced new screening criteria for foreign workers, including a requirement that H-1B applicants and their dependents set their social media privacy settings to “public” for official review. The additional scrutiny significantly prolonged visa appointment processing and approvals, creating fresh uncertainty for employees’ travel and work schedules. Speaking at Fortune’s Workforce Innovation Summit, Hiba Mona Anver, a partner at Erickson Immigration Group, explained that companies now face the challenge of adjusting to a rapidly shifting regulatory landscape. She noted that the crackdown has prompted many firms to develop a “plan C” to ensure continuity in senior leadership and technical roles. The visa policy changes affect a broad cross-section of U.S. businesses. According to available data, 80% of companies currently have at least one immigrant serving in a top leadership position, underscoring the potential impact on corporate decision-making if talent mobility is further constrained. From an investment perspective, the escalating uncertainty around U.S. visa policy could influence corporate risk profiles. Companies that rely on a globally sourced workforce may face higher compliance costs and potential talent shortages in key innovation areas. The need to develop alternative plans—such as relocating certain roles outside the U.S. or accelerating local hiring—could create short-term operational disruptions. While the long-term economic impact remains unclear, market participants are likely to monitor how major employers adjust their talent strategies. Any shift away from the U.S. as a primary hub for skilled labor might alter the competitive landscape for sectors like technology, research, and engineering. It is also worth noting that immigration policy changes are subject to legal challenges and potential revisions. Therefore, investors should consider the possibility of further volatility in labor‑dependent industries without overreacting to individual announcements.
